Srashen (Armenian: Սրաշեն) is a village in the Kapan Municipality of the Syunik Province in Armenia.
Toponymy
The village was previously known as Kilisakyand.
Demographics
Population
The National Statistical Service of the Republic of Armenia (ARMSTAT) reported its population was 91 in 2010,[3] down from 105 at the 2001 census.[4]
